Flight 031. The mystery of the British Airways flights avoiding French airspace. ANA flies the Star Wars crew from LAX to LHR. No more hover boards in planes. Kayak launches Snap, the SMS-based booking service. ATL reaches 100m passengers in 2015. How many economy seats can you cram in a 747 or an A380? Disembarking a 737 with a ladder. Don’t believe everything you read, MH132 didn’t get lost in Australia.ANA Star Wars
